Aktuelle Zeit: Samstag 23. November 2024, 23:17

Alle Zeiten sind UTC + 1 Stunde [ Sommerzeit ]




 Seite 1 von 1 [ 3 Beiträge ] 
Autor Nachricht
 Betreff des Beitrags: mit ida pro code ändern?
BeitragVerfasst: Donnerstag 16. Juli 2009, 22:05 
Brennmeisteranwärter
Benutzeravatar

Registriert: Montag 19. September 2005, 02:44
Beiträge: 998
ich will mit ida pro code für einen motorola-prozessor verändern (ausser ida kann kaum einer mit motorola umgehen)

bsp.:
RESERVED:4C58 jsr sub_6141
RESERVED:4C5B dex
RESERVED:4C5C bne loc_4C58

den jsr auf eine andere adresse lenken, wo ich selbstgeschriebenen code einfügen kann.

a la
jsr sub_7400

aber ida läßt keine veränderungen zu, weder im codefenster noch im hexfenster. :burn:

bin ich nur zu dösig oder geht das wirklich nicht?



_________________
Vista?
wer braucht denn diesen Mist da?

Einmaliges Angebot:
Bestellen sie jetzt das gesamte Internet auf 6.827.325.212 DVD´s, oder auf 3 CD´s ohne Pornos!
Offline
 Profil  
 
 Betreff des Beitrags: Re: mit ida pro code ändern?
BeitragVerfasst: Freitag 17. Juli 2009, 15:54 
Administrator
Benutzeravatar

Registriert: Donnerstag 22. September 2005, 20:01
Beiträge: 6113
Wohnort: /etc/
den Sprung wo du siehst ist nicht direkt auf eine Adresse sondern auf eine Subroutine mit dem Namen sub_7400 , mit IDA selbst kannst da nicht viel machen , wenn überhaupt mit einem Hex Editor werkeln !!

aber wer sagt das die Binary die du Deassembliert hast nicht gepackt bzw. geschützt ist wenn beides der Fall ist wirst du eh nichts mit deinem Deassembliertem Code anfangen können .

cu



_________________
"Die Falschheit herrschet, die Hinterlist bei dem feigen Menschengeschlechte."

MBQ I : ASRock Z77 Pro 4 - i7 3770K@4.2GHz - 16GB XMS3@1800- R9 290 Winforce 3xOC - 2*WD1002FAEX@RAID0 + WD2002FAEX - 2*SDSSDHP128GB@RAID0 - Creative Audigy 2ZS - CPU@BQ SP-450 + GPU@BQ PP-CM-730 - PLX2783HSU@74Hz - Arvo + Bloody V7M - Win8.1 Pro WMC 64Bit
Offline
 Profil  
 
 Betreff des Beitrags: Re: mit ida pro code ändern?
BeitragVerfasst: Freitag 17. Juli 2009, 17:45 
Brennmeisteranwärter
Benutzeravatar

Registriert: Montag 19. September 2005, 02:44
Beiträge: 998
danke erstmal für die resonanz .....


ich sag das ;) ist aus einem eprom.bin

es geht übrigens doch mit ida über edit > other > manual instruction
darüber lassen sich code/werte verändern/schreiben und so wies aussieht kann ich den sogar in einen hexeditor kopieren.

ist schon ewig her, das ich direkt in assembler 'herumgepfuscht' habe, muß mich erstmal etwas einarbeiten :afraid:

ziel ist es erstmal, eine org. routine leicht zu verändern und speicherinhalte auf veränderung zu überprüfen a la
lda speicherstelleninhalt
ldx wert
cmp usw...

also was eigentlich simples



_________________
Vista?
wer braucht denn diesen Mist da?

Einmaliges Angebot:
Bestellen sie jetzt das gesamte Internet auf 6.827.325.212 DVD´s, oder auf 3 CD´s ohne Pornos!
Offline
 Profil  
 
Beiträge der letzten Zeit anzeigen:  Sortiere nach  
 Seite 1 von 1 [ 3 Beiträge ] 

Alle Zeiten sind UTC + 1 Stunde [ Sommerzeit ]


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 13 Gäste


Du darfst keine neuen Themen in diesem Forum erstellen.
Du darfst keine Antworten zu Themen in diesem Forum erstellen.
Du darfst deine Beiträge in diesem Forum nicht ändern.
Du darfst deine Beiträge in diesem Forum nicht löschen.
Du darfst keine Dateianhänge in diesem Forum erstellen.

Suche nach:
Gehe zu: